Update the RF, RFGAIN, MODE, INI, and BBGAIN initialization tables
authorreyk <reyk@openbsd.org>
Wed, 30 Jul 2008 07:15:39 +0000 (07:15 +0000)
committerreyk <reyk@openbsd.org>
Wed, 30 Jul 2008 07:15:39 +0000 (07:15 +0000)
commitb59011f96c26d9a90fe08b452484f47bdbe97c5b
tree6b8be880c757d82df208c4d40216436487ec4bb1
parent62ca8315cba6a9903d903aa99568be9cb5460e1b
Update the RF, RFGAIN, MODE, INI, and BBGAIN initialization tables
with different versions for various ar5212 variants and add an extra
table for PCI-E devices.  This fixes support for various newer devices
(like the 1st generation MacBook, T61 variants) but it still does not
work on a number of other devices.

Tested by many
ok deraadt@
sys/dev/ic/ar5211.c
sys/dev/ic/ar5212.c
sys/dev/ic/ar5212reg.h
sys/dev/ic/ar5212var.h
sys/dev/ic/ar5xxx.c
sys/dev/ic/ar5xxx.h